Access SSH on Your PC with XShell

XShell is a robust terminal designed to facilitate secure sessions via the SSH protocol. For users who want to control with remote servers, XShell offers an intuitive and powerful platform. Its user-friendly interface makes it accessible for both beginners and experienced users. With its comprehensive options, XShell empowers you to run tasks remotely with precision.

  • Establish secure SSH connections to remote servers.
  • Move files between your local machine and the remote server.
  • Adjust various settings to optimize your SSH experience.
  • Employ advanced features like tabbed browsing and scripting.

XShell Alternatives: Exploring Other Remote Access Solutions

While XShell has earned a reputation as a reliable remote access tool, other solutions are emerging that may better suit your needs.

If you're exploring alternatives to XShell, consider the following options:

  • MobaXterm: A popular SSH client known for its simplicity.
